Proton‐motive‐force‐driven sucrose uptake in sugar beet plasma membrane vesicles | |

【 摘 要 】
Highly purified plasma membranes were prepared by aqueous two-phase partioning from sugar beet (Beta vulgaris L.) leaf microsomes. Uptake of sucrose was studied with non-energized vesicles and with vesicles artificially energized by a pH gradient (ΔpH) or a pH gradient plus an electrical gradient (ΔpH+Δψ). In non-energized vesicles, sucrose was taken up via a diffusion-like system until attainment of concentration equilibrium. Energized vesicles rapidly accumulated sucrose with accumulation ratios of 6 and 12 (vs the external concentration) for vesicles energized by ΔpH and ΔpH + Δψ, respectively. Energized uptake exhibited saturation kinetics, and was sensitive to carbonyl cyanide m-chlorophenylhydrazone and N-ethylmaleimide.
